NZSTA Trustee Accreditation Process
NZSTA is proud to launch the NZSTA Trustee Accreditation Process.
NZSTA wants to offer trustees of member boards the opportunity to demonstrate their commitment to strengthening school governance by becoming a NZSTA Accredited Trustee.
The aim of the NZSTA Trustee Accreditation Process: to support and strengthen school governance in New Zealand State and State Integrated Schools is in accordance with NZSTA’s strategic training statement:
“To up- skill boards for effective governance outcomes.”
You may want to gain accreditation to:
· show your community that you have the required skills to be an effective trustee at election time
· be listed on the NZSTA database of trustees available to be co-opted or selected
· demonstrate your ability as a trustee to the MOE, and as a potential resource in providing assistance to other
boards, e.g. as a mentor, commissioner or LSM for another board.
· provide evidence of your experience as a trustee to use towards further directorships.
A database of accredited trustees will be maintained in the members’ area of the NZSTA website.
